ionic使用中所遇到的坑

总结一下我在使用ionic3中所遇到的问题在这里总结下:

  1. 首先最新版ionic在我们构建好项目、启动成功后,修改过文件或者是刷新浏览器的情况下,我们的ionic项目运行在终端的servce会中断
    这是因为其中一个模块的问题(ws),进入到node_module中删除他,之后在命令行执行 npm install ws@3.3.2 –save, 安装完毕后
    重新启动项目,搞定。

  2. 在构建服务时,有时候会忘记引入http服务,我们在组建中药引入http模块,同样在app.module.ts中也要引入httpModule模块, 否则会报错。

  3. 我们在写代码时,常常会遇到跨域问题,解决ionic3跨域问题的方法:
    我们找到项目根目录下的ionic.config.json配置文件,在里面添加如下配置

    1
    2
    3
    4
    5
    6
    "proxies": [
    {
    "path": "/list",
    "proxyUrl": "https://m.toutiao.com/list/"
    }
    ]
0%